Transaction 523ce5a05b99ec556256f23b2be8a7241693a4e39733ab50bc9dcf5d9faa4080
1 Input
1 Output
-
523ce5a05b99ec556256f23b2be8a7241693a4e39733ab50bc9dcf5d9faa4080:0
- value
- 154686
- script pubkey
- OP_0 OP_PUSHBYTES_20 f51ecc4ef91c837ba5ac9854346553022d8423eb
- address
- bc1q750vcnherjphhfdvnp2rge2nqgkcggltq93mfj